#Navigation h2 { display: none !important; }
#InnerMeinVerein {padding-top:500px;}
#Content {padding-top: 30px;}
#IE6_7 #Content {padding-top: 15px;}

.category_list { background-color: transparent; margin-top: 5px; }
.category_list .box > span {  display: none;}

.flash_teaser {margin-top: 4px; height: 390px; width: 980px; overflow: hidden;}
.loginBox .box_wrapper { background-color: #f2f2f2; }

.loginform {margin-top:10px;}
.loginform fieldset {border:0;}
.loginform .formContent {padding:10px 0 5px 10px !important;}
.loginform dt label {font-weight:bold !important;}
.loginform dt.help {visibility: hidden;}
.loginform div.submit p {position: absolute; right:10px; bottom: 15px;}
.loginform .help a {font-size:9px;}

.loginform .textInputWrapper { width: 230px }

.category_list .list_entry{ padding: 3px 5px; }
.card_list .category_card { height: 80px; padding: 0; width:150px; padding-top: 180px;}
.card_list .category_card, .card_list .category_card .media_wrapper { background: white;  }
#MainContent .category_card .media_wrapper { top: 32px; }
.category_card > span.right { right: 2px; }

#Body .category_card .mcard_content ,#Body .category_card .caption{ background: transparent url('/img/sprites/category_card.gif') 0 0 no-repeat; }
#Body .card_list .category_card .mcard_content { padding: 0 12px; height: 84px; background-position: -0 54px; position: relative; z-index: 10; width: 130px; left: -2px; top:-2px;}
#Body .category_card .caption {position: absolute; top: -23px; left: -2px; z-index: 10; width: 130px; height: 19px; padding: 32px 12px 9px 12px; color: white; font-size: 12px;}
#Body .category_card .yellow { background-position: 0 -30px; }
#Body .category_card .green { background-position: 0 -150px; }
#Body .category_card .red { background-position: 0 -90px; }
#Body .category_card .violett { background-position: 0 -210px; }
.card_list .category_card dd li {background: url(/img/sprites/dots.gif) 0 100% repeat-x; padding: 2px 0; padding-bottom: 3px;}
.card_list .category_card dd li.last {background-image:none;}

.noScript #Body .category_card { width: 150px; }

#IE6 .card_list .category_card dd li {border-style: solid;}

#IE6 #Body .category_card .mcard_content {
background-image: none;
border-bottom: 1px solid #d6d6d6;
width: 126px;
left:0;
overflow: hidden;
margin-bottom: -2px;}
#IE6 #Body .card_list .category_card { width: 146px;  margin: 0; }

#NavigationList li.active a, #NavigationList li.first_active a { padding-bottom: 11px; }

#mv_quick { height:230px; }

.frontpageBanners { position:absolute; right: -215px;  top: 0px; z-index: 9999; width: 202px; }
.frontpageBanners .container .top { background-image: url(../../img/frontpage/header.gif); padding: 10px; color: #FFFFFF; font-size: 17px; font-family: Helvetica, arial, verdana, sans-serif; font-weight: bold; margin-top: 10px; cursor: pointer; }
.frontpageBanners .container .content { cursor: pointer; }

